A word about the equipment we use.

The scope is an Opticron 80 GA ED/45 with a 20-60x HDF eyepiece. Images are bright and clear and the controls are user-friendly.
Next came the camera... the Nikon P6000 with a dazzling array of shooting modes and options that will have to be mastered.
To join the scope to the camera required an Opticron adapter with a special diameter tapered insert sleeve for locking down and a screw in Nikon sleeve fit with a step down ring.
A shutter release cable and attachment were also purchased to stop camera shake.
